Abstract
A wide generalization of the classical theorem of A. Grothendieck asserting that for any faithfully flat extension of commutative rings, the corresponding relative Picard group and the Amitsur 1-cohomology group with values in the units-functor are isomorphic, is obtained. This implies some known results that are concerned with extending to non-commutative rings of Grothendieck's theorem.
